+Changes With Apache Tuscany SCA 2.0-M2 April 2009
+=================================================
+
+Highlights include:
+- OSGi Enhancements including support for <implementation.osgi> and a new OSGi RFC119 prototype
+- Many updates towards support for OASIS OpenCSA specification and the use OASIS namespaces and schemas
+- Start to implement the SCA policy framework 1.1 spec draft from OASIS OpenCSA
+- New Endpoint and EndpoitReference structures
+- Webapps integration support including <implementation.web> and the web application composite along
+- with support for various web technologies and frameworks including JSP support, JSF support with
+- Apache MyFaces, and integration with the Stripes Web Framework
+- New Maven Archetypes to make developing SCA applications easier
